Cam Crotty inks entry-level deal with Coyotes
Boston University defenseman Cam Crotty signed a three-year entry-level contract with the Arizona Coyotes on Thursday. The details of the deal have yet to be announced, in accordance with a team policy. Trevor Zegras signs pro deal with Anaheim Ducks
Trevor Zegras inked a three-year professional contract with the Anaheim Ducks on Friday evening, leaving Boston University after one season.
